Net Wall Area
The net wall area includes the opaque wall area of all above-grade walls enclosing conditioned spaces, the opaque area of conditioned basement walls less than 50% below grade (including the below-grade portions), and peripheral edges of floors. The net wall area does not include windows, doors, or other such openings, as they are treated separately.

Non-Standard Part Load Value (NPLV)
A single-number, part-load efficiency figure of merit calculated and referenced to conditions other than IPLV conditions, for units that are not designed to operate at ARI Standard Rating Conditions.
Non-Recirculating System
A domestic or service hot water distribution system that is not a recirculating system.
Non-Renewable Energy
Energy derived from a fossil fuel source.
Non-Residential
All occupancies other than residential.
North-Oriented
Facing within 45 degrees of true north (northern hemisphere).
